Looking for Estate Planning Lawyers in Lakeview?

Estate planning attorneys help individuals prepare for the management and distribution of their assets after death or incapacitation. They create legal documents such as wills, trusts, powers of attorney, and healthcare directives. Their work ensures a client’s wishes are honored, minimizes potential taxes, and simplifies the process for their loved ones.

How can I leave my house to child?

default-avatar
Answered by attorney James P Frederick (Unclaimed Profile)
Estate Planning lawyer at Frederick & Frederick Attorneys at Law
You do not say how old the child is. If the child is a minor, she cannot hold title to property. If she is a minor, the only good option is to establish a trust. If she is not a minor, then there are other possibilities, depending on your facts. A lady bird deed might be a good option, for example.
